DeepMind’s Demis Hassabis: A.I. Is Overhyped Now however Underappreciated

For Demis Hassabis, CEO of Google DeepMind, there’s little doubt that components of the A.I. trade are in a bubble. The more durable query, he says, is determining which areas are fueled by hype and which really have the potential to be transformative.

“There are components of the A.I. ecosystem which are in all probability in bubbles,” Hassabis mentioned throughout a current episode of Google DeepMind: The Podcast. He pointed to the hovering valuations of nascent startups as a specific pink flag, noting that firms touchdown “tens of billions of {dollars} valuations simply out of the gate” are in all probability not sustainable.

It shouldn’t come as a shock that Hassabis doesn’t put DeepMind, co-founded by him in 2010 and nonetheless led by him following Alphabet’s 2014 acquisition, on this class. On the subject of funding from Massive Tech, he mentioned, “there’s lots of actual enterprise underlying that.” A.I., in his view, is “overhyped within the quick time period and nonetheless underappreciated within the medium to long run.”

Hassabis’ confidence is rooted in firsthand expertise, notably in science. Final yr, he gained a Nobel Prize in Chemistry for his work on AlphaFold, an A.I. system that predicts protein buildings. He additionally leads Isomorphic Labs, an Alphabet subsidiary targeted on making use of A.I. drug discovery.

Nonetheless, Hassabis is clear-eyed about how far the know-how has to go, particularly relating to superior milestones like AGI. At present’s techniques can ship Ph.D.-level efficiency in some areas, even incomes honors like gold medals from the Worldwide Mathematical Olympiad, whereas nonetheless making fundamental errors. Closing these inconsistencies is important, he mentioned. “We’ve obtained to shut these gaps.”

Past pushing towards human-level intelligence, Google DeepMind is targeted on constructing so-called world fashions—techniques that perceive not simply language, however the bodily world itself. Via merchandise like its Genie techniques, the lab is engaged on A.I. that may grasp how objects transfer and work together. That type of bodily understanding, Hassabis mentioned, is essential for advances in robotics and common assistants.

World fashions may additionally reshape gaming, a longtime ardour of the Google DeepMind CEO. Hassabis started his profession as a online game programmer, later founding Elixir Studios, a video games improvement firm, and serving as lead A.I. programmer at Lionhead Studios. Bodily A.I., he prompt, may at some point allow “the final word sport—which in fact, was perhaps all the time my unconscious plan.”

At present, Hassabis is considered one of a small group of leaders shaping the way forward for A.I. He describes himself as pleasant “with just about all of them,” referring to fellow tech executives—a stage of concord that isn’t common within the discipline. “A number of the others don’t get on with one another.”

These cordial relationships don’t erase the aggressive strain. Google is racing alongside opponents like OpenAI, Meta and Anthropic to realize AGI, a contest that has unleashed a wave of funding harking back to the dot-com growth. “It’s onerous, as a result of we’re additionally in essentially the most ferocious capitalist competitors there’s ever been.”
